What color is 88BAD7?

The RGB color code for color number #88BAD7 is RGB(136, 186, 215). In the RGB color model, #88BAD7 has a red value of 136, a green value of 186, and a blue value of 215.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 36.7% cyan, 13.5% magenta, 0.0% yellow, and 15.7%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 202° (degrees), 49.7 % saturation, and 68.8 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#88BAD7 has a hue of 202° (degrees), 36.7 % saturation and 84.3 % brightness/value.



Color 88BAD7 is cool or warm?

Color 88BAD7 is a cool color.



What is the LRV of #88BAD7? (For interior and product design)

88BAD7 has an LRV of nearly 45. By LRV value, it is a medium light color.

Light Reflectance Value (LRV) is a measure of how much visible light is reflected off a surface. It is a number on a scale of 0 to 100, with 0 being pure black and 100 being pure white. The higher the LRV, the more light the color reflects and the lighter it will appear.

Is #88BAD7 Readable? WCAG Contrast Checker (For digital design)

Check if the color 88BAD7 meets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) standards, minimum contrast ratio standards between text and background colors. The W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ines) provides global standards for readable web content.

WCAG Recommendations - Large Text: above 18pt or 14pt bold. Normal Text: below 18pt or 14pt bold.

  • Minimum contrast ratio (AA): 4.5 for normal text and 3 for large text.
  • Enhanced contrast ratio (AAA): 7 for normal text and 4.5 for large text.

Complementary / Opposite Color

Complementary colors are pairs of colors which, when combined or mixed, cancel each other out (lose hue) by producing a grayscale color like white or black. When placed next to each other, they create the strongest contrast for those two colors. Complementary colors also called opposite colors. Complementary color schemes are created using two opposite colors on the color wheel. The examples are red–cyan, green–magenta, and blue–yellow.
